Belgian charities will help to improve on the region health and social services

In the Ternopil region are the Chairman of the charity Fund "Ukrainian project in Edegem" Lillian Bollert and Director of the Foundation "Child-HelpInternational" Pierre Mertens. With representatives of the Belgian charity funds August 31 officially met Deputy Chairman of the Ternopil regional state administration Yuriy Yura, and heads of departments. During the meeting the sides outlined the directions of further cooperation and interaction to solve practical problems. "It's important for us to learn from your valuable experience, aimed at improving the quality of services in healthcare and social sphere", — said Yuri Yurik. During the meeting the parties discussed the possibility of providing medico-social assistance to children with hydrocephalus, as well as palliative care to residents of Ternopil. We also plan to support the children's home, hospice, geriatric homes and elderly people. Lillian Bollert helps Ukraine for more than 20 years. Provides palliative care, solves problems of older people, working on social projects for people with disabilities. Pierre Mertens is working on a project Back BFF and hydrocephalus", the social protection of children. "I consider myself kind of a lawyer low — income citizens, said Lillian Bollert. — By the way, we can mutually share experiences, because I was pleasantly surprised by the development of medical institutions in Ukraine. Check out mobile medical teams to areas of the region, for example. In Belgium there is no such". Also the event was attended by our countryman, doctor Vanko Igor, a Ukrainian volunteer in Belgium. He works closely with Lillian Bollert, which helps him to raise funds for the vacuum pump for Ukrainian hospitals. Such devices treat purulent wounds, helps patients to avoid amputation. "the agenda is the question of providing additional hospice beds for seriously ill children. Therefore, with the support of Lillian and Pierre, we plan to make it happen. In addition, representatives of the Belgian charity foundations ready to help us provide medications, as well as to share practical experience with the physicians of Ternopil region", — said the head of the Department of health Ternopil regional state administration Volodymyr Bogaychuk.
